Sargent & Lundy is a consulting firm that supports utility-scale solar, wind, battery energy storage, thermal power, and other power and infrastructure projects. The Mid-Level Geotechnical Engineer will perform high quality design and consulting services as part of multidisciplined project teams for challenging domestic and international projects.
Responsibilities:
- Prepare geotechnical reports and calculations for conformity with project specifications
- Prepare specifications for subsurface investigations, deep foundations, ground improvement, earth retaining systems, monitoring wells, water production wells, and general earthwork
- Advise power project developers to support new utility-scale solar, wind, battery energy storage, thermal, and other projects
- Evaluate new power and infrastructure projects independently to support financing
- Develop technical reports for applicable audiences – including owners, developers, governmental agencies and committees, and financiers
- Conduct occasional on-site quality surveillance of subsurface exploration programs, pile installation and pile testing
- Occasional domestic and/or international travel
Requirements:
- This position requires a bachelor's degree in civil engineering with a geotechnical focus
- 5+ years of detailed geotechnical design, including soil remediation, deep foundations, driven, predrilled, and helical pile design
- Experience in working in design of power, transmission, or other heavy industry projects, including on-site quality surveillance of subsurface exploration programs, pile installation and pile testing
- Experience in writing and providing support documentation for Geotechnical Engineering specifications or calculations
